The Function of Electromagnetic Pulse Valves in Modern Irrigation Systems
Precision in water management is a growing focus in both agriculture and landscape maintenance. A key component enabling this precision is the electromagnetic pulse valve. This device acts as a digitally controlled gate for water flow, allowing for the automated operation of irrigation systems based on programmed schedules or sensor inputs.
The performance of an electromagnetic pulse valve is based on its electromechanical design. When an electrical signal is sent from a controller, it generates a magnetic field that lifts a small plunger inside the valve. This action releases pressure from a diaphragm, causing it to open and allow water to pass through. Once the electrical pulse ceases, the diaphragm closes, stopping the water flow. The reliability of an electromagnetic pulse valve is crucial, as it must perform this open-close cycle thousands of times without failure. Key performance aspects include a low power requirement, which allows it to be used in solar-powered systems, and a fast response time, enabling precise control over watering duration. A well-engineered electromagnetic pulse valve is also designed to resist clogging from small debris, ensuring consistent operation over time.
From a user experience standpoint, the electromagnetic pulse valve is largely an unseen but vital component. For a farmer or a grounds manager, the benefit lies in the automation and efficiency it provides. By integrating these valves into a system, they can ensure that water is delivered to specific zones at the optimal time of day and for the exact duration needed, without manual intervention. This not only saves labor but also contributes to significant water conservation. The ability to control an electromagnetic pulse valve remotely via a timer or a smart system offers flexibility and allows for easy adjustments based on weather conditions. The overall experience is one of greater control and resource optimization, making the electromagnetic pulse valve a fundamental element in building a responsive and efficient irrigation infrastructure.
